Bianca’s back with new tracks

Former 'Idols SA' contestant Bianca le Grange launched her latest album, 'Net Jy/Just You', in Cape Town on Monday evening.


The album, le Grange’s fourth full-length studio effort, includes seventeen songs in English and Afrikaans. The first single, ‘Kaapse Water’, is currently receiving air time on local radio stations.

The 31-year-old singer, who was placed fourth in the first season of the television singing show, insists that the new release’s Afrikaans tracks are a reflection of who she is.

She explained: “My fans were a bit upset when I started doing Afrikaans music, but it’s me, that’s my roots.”

The Pretoria-born talent has just finished a stint on stage in Cape Town, starring in the local adaptation of West End musical production ‘Blood Brothers’, directed by David Kramer.
